Introduction
ELECFREKAS Motor:bit is a kind of motor drive board based on micro:bit. It has integrated a motor drive chip TB6612, which can drive two DC motors with 1.2A max single channel current. Motor:bit has integrated Octopus series' sensor connectors. You can plug various sensors into it directly. Among these connectors, P0, P3-P7, P9-P10 support sensors with 3.3V power voltage only; P13-P16, P19-P20 support 3.3V or 5V sensors. You can change electric level by sliding the switch on the board.

Hardware 
Features:
- Motor Drive Chip: TB6612
- Support GVS-Octopus electric Bricks' connector
- Some GVS connectors support electric level switch between 3.3V and 5V.
- With 2 channels DC motor connectors, max single channel current is 1.2A.
- Input Voltage: DC 6-12V
- Dimension: 60.00mm X 60.10mm
- Weight: 30 g
Application:
- It is compatible with ElecFreaks Octopus electric bricks module series due to its built-in 3 pin IO electric brick GVS extension connector.
- It can be used as the development board of mini smart cars and balance cars.
- Users can develop mobile-controlled robot, robot arms, etc..

Detailed Introduction Of Some Connectors:
1)    VCC Switch-3.3V/5V electric level switch.
Slide switch to the end of 5V, the electric level of the blue pins (P13、P14、P15、P16、P19、P20) on motor:bit is 5V, and the voltage of the red power pins is 5V too. Similarly, when slide switch to 3.3V, the voltage of blue pins and red pins are 3.3V.

- Digital Pin Connector.Digital pins: P4、P5、P6、P7、P9、P10.
 G-3V3-S connector: 3V3 stands for 3.3V power voltage, G is for GND, S is for signal. GVS is a standard sensor connector, which enables you to plug onto servos and various sensors conveniently. At the same time, it supports our Octopus Bricks
 series'products. 
- 3.3V/5V dual electric level GND-VCC-SIG connector:P13, P14, P15, P16, P19, P20.The specialty of G-VCC-SIG connector lies in that it can support 3.3V or 5V power device by shifting electric level of 3.3V/ 5V through VCC connector. At the same time, it supports our Octopus Bricks series' products. 
- Motor Input Connector: Two motor input connectors in total. M1+, M1- and M2+, M2- separately controls a channel of DC motor.M1,M2 Motor Control Instruction: P8 and P12 relatively controls the rotating direction of M1 and M2; P1 and P2 control motor speed. - ProgrammingPositive Rotation Of Motor:P8 in high electric level means the positive rotation of motor. You can adjust the logic value of P1 to control motor speed. 
 Negative Rotation Of Motor:P8 in low voltage level means the negative rotation of motor. ou can adjust the logic value of P1 to control motor speed.
